Know Your Headcount

Your guest count is the foundation of every catering decision. Create a list of everyone invited and then estimate how many will actually attend. For workplace events, you can usually plan for most people to show up; for more casual gatherings, build in a small buffer.

When in doubt, plan for a few extra meals so no one is left out. Leftover steak, grilled chicken, or grilled shrimp is always better than running short.

Estimate How Much Food to Order

Getting the right amount of food is one of the biggest questions in any catering plan. While every group is different, a few guidelines can help you estimate confidently.

Think in Portions per Person

For most events, planning one main item per person is a good starting point. For example, if you are ordering steak or grilled chicken meals, match the number of meals to your guest count plus a small buffer for last-minute additions.

Consider the Type and Length of Event

Groups tend to eat more at evening events or longer gatherings. If your event runs several hours or includes a lot of activity, consider adding a few extra meals or sides so guests can go back for seconds.

Set Up Your Serving Area

A little preparation at your event space makes serving fast and easy. Before your Steak-Out catering arrives, clear a table or counter where guests can move through comfortably.

Arrange plates, napkins, and utensils at the start of the line, followed by main items, sides, and desserts. Keep drinks in a separate area to avoid bottlenecks. If you are using individual meals, group similar meals together and label them clearly so guests can quickly find their choice.
